Java数据结构和算法精讲版 顶

01、整体课程内容概览

02、数组和数组操作

03、有序数组和二分法

04、冒泡和选择排序

05、插入法和对象排序

06、栈和栈的操作实现

07、栈的应用实例

08、中缀变后缀表达式

09、计算后缀表达式

10、队列和队列操作

11、双端和优先级队列

12、链表和链表操作

13、双端链表实现

14、有序链表和排序

15、双向链表及实现

16、递归和分治算法

17、斐波那契数列和汉诺塔

18、背包问题

19、归并排序

20、希尔排序

21、快速排序

22、基数排序

23、二叉树概念和性质

24、二叉搜索树实现

25、二叉搜索树删除

26、哈夫曼编码和树

27、哈夫曼算法实现压缩-1

28、哈夫曼算法实现压缩-2

29、哈夫曼算法实现压缩-3

30、哈夫曼算法实现解压-1

31、哈夫曼算法实现解压-2

32、红黑树规则和修正

33、红黑树节点插入-1

34、红黑树节点插入-2

35、红黑树节点删除-1

36、红黑树节点删除-2

37、2-3-4树基础和规则

38、2-3-4树的实现-1

39、2-3-4树的实现-2

40、2-3-4树的实现-3

41、B树特性和高度

42、B树搜索和新增-1

43、B树搜索和新增-2

44、B树删除实现-1

45、B树删除实现-2

46、B树删除实现-3

47、Hash规则和冲突

48、线性探测和再哈希

49、链地址法和Hash化字符串

50、堆的特点和操作-1

51、堆操作-2和堆排序

52、图的术语和程序表达

53、深度优先搜索

54、广度优先搜索和最小生成树

55、有向图的拓扑排序

56、有向图的连通

57、普里姆算法-1

58、普里姆算法-2

59、迪杰斯特拉算法

60、弗洛伊德算法

资料+源码.rar

    原文作者:红黑树
    原文地址: https://my.oschina.net/u/3701554/blog/1819955
    本文转自网络文章,转载此文章仅为分享知识,如有侵权,请联系博主进行删除。
点赞